Measurements or Trace The default setting, Measurement, allows you to
perform measurements, either in synchronous (call)
mode or asynchronous (measure) mode. If you
change this scroll field to Sign.Trace instead, no
measurements are available but normal call proce-
dures can be made. You can then see the protocol
trace on various layers. See chapter Signalling
Trace in this manual.
Duplex In trunked mode, receive and transmit frequency
differ by a defined spacing called the duplex spac-
ing. The default is 10 MHz because this is the most
commonly used setting. Other values may be used
such as 8 MHz or 45 MHz. Consult with your net-
work operator or mobile manufacturer to find out the
value used by the mobile phone under test.
